In open fibers the fiber wall may be a permselective membrane, and uses include dialysis, ultrafiltration, reverse osmosis, Dorman exchange (dialysis), osmotic pumping, pervaporation, gaseous separation, and stream filtration. Alternatively, the fiber wall may act as a catalytic reactor and immobilization of catalyst and enzyme in the wall entity may occur. Loaded fibers are used as sorbents, and in ion exchange and controlled release. Special uses of hoUow fibers include tissue-culture growth, heat exchangers, and others. [Pg.146]

Entities involved in long-term contracts with electric utihties, such as fuel supphers and NUGs selling power to utihties, also have concerns that some utihties or industrial customers will not be able to honor their contracts under the new, more competitive system. Einahy, some utihties are concerned that they wih not be adequately reimbursed for opening up their transmission systems to competitors. The potential competitors in turn are concerned that utihties whl not provide unbiased access to their transmission systems if the utihties themselves are also in business of marketing power. There has also been some debate regarding which transmission facihties are eligible for open access. This is because some facihties are considered local distribution systems by utihties, which feel they should not be opened to competitors. [Pg.89]

With the opening of the transmission network to all resource suppliers, many marketing entities entered the game in the mid-1990s. Many of these marketers are subsidiaries of already established gas suppliers. Some have been created solely for the electric industry. Still others have been formed from the utilities themselves. All of these etitities arc competition-motivated. Facility planning and reliability issues, while important to their business, are left to other organizations. [Pg.1202]

As outlined in Section III.A, knowledge of the molecular wavefunction implies knowledge of the electron distribution. By setting a threshold value for this function, the molecular boundaries can be established, and the path is open to a definition of molecular shape. A quicker, but quite effective, approach to this entity is taken by assuming that each atom in a molecule contributes an electron sphere, and that the overall shape of a molecular object results from interpenetration of these spheres. The necessary radii can be obtained by working backwards from the results of MO calculations21, or from some kind of empirical fitting22. [Pg.29]

The process of classification is typically based on systematically arranging entities on the basis of their similarities and differences. A bowl of fruit can be systematically arranged to have apples on one side and bananas on the other. Chemical elements can be systematically arranged into distinct families on the basis of their atomic structures. Classification of this sort is relatively easy and can be grounded on any number of relatively distinctive parameters or combinations of parameters, including color, size, shape, structure, taste, and so forth. We have already noted that psychiatric disorders are best characterized as open concepts. In open psychiatric concepts, overt, objective, and distinctive parameters are often less apparent, making their classification considerably more difficult. [Pg.8]

Evaluation of the concept of mental illness suggests that there are other aspects of its definition that create variability. Lilienfeld and Marino (1995) stated that there has always been great difficulty in establishing the boundary between mental illness and normalcy. These authors suggested that we need to accept this fuzzy boundary as a necessary condition of mental illness. They argued that mental illnesses should be considered open concepts (Meehl, 1977) or Roschian concepts (Rosch, 1973). A Roschian concept is essentially the same as the open concept we have already defined. It is a mental construction used to categorize natural entities that are characterized by fuzzy boundaries.
